What Are The Various Sorts Of Wills And What Should They Consist Of?

That is, after withdrawing the prior will, the testator might have made an alternate plan of disposition. Such a strategy would show that the testator intended the abrogation to result in the home going in other places, as opposed to simply being a revoked disposition. Secondly, courts call for either that the testator have actually recited their error in the regards to the withdrawing instrument, or that the error be established by clear and convincing proof. Willful physical destruction of a will by the testator will certainly withdraw it, through purposely burning or tearing the physical document itself, or by striking out the trademark. In most jurisdictions, partial revocation is allowed if only part of the text or a particular arrangement is gone across out.

No, your will certainly does not require to be sworn to be thought about legitimately valid in Canada. It is a typical misunderstanding that you need a notary or legal representative to make a lawfully legitimate will in Canada. While most of wills are supported, if the court chooses a will is void it can either put an earlier will in place if one exists or disperse properties according to federal government intestacy legislations. You need to additionally consist of several back-up executors in situation the primary executor is unable or reluctant to act in this function. Your will certainly must outline the properties, buildings, items, and money that will be dispersed to every of your recipients. It should also consist of a stipulation that outlines what occurs if a recipient passes away prior to you and exactly how their possessions will be dispersed. You do not need to include any particular items in your will, unless you're gifting it to a Estate Planning particular individual. Any kind of things not provided as a details present will be included in your recurring estate and dispersed appropriately. Dispersing your assets and personal property is maybe the most important part of your will. To stop any type of confusion or disagreements, it's vital to be particular in detailing each asset and the beneficiary it need to go to. This can be done by utilizing a substantial possessions and personal property list, which gives a clear and orderly document of your properties and their designated recipients. With this in mind, it's important to select someone you trust to function as your executor. Not just should this person want and capable to act in this function, but they need to also meet legal needs.
